Top 5 Best 39701 Mississippi Public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 6 public schools serving 1,321 students in 39701, MS (there are 1 private school, serving 20 private students). 99% of all K-12 students in 39701, MS are educated in public schools (compared to the MS state average of 90%).
The top ranked public schools in 39701, MS are West Lowndes Elementary School, West Lowndes High School and Stokes Beard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public schools in zipcode 39701 have an average math proficiency score of 17% (versus the Mississippi public school average of 35%), and reading proficiency score of 18% (versus the 35% statewide average). Schools in 39701, MS have an average ranking of 3/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Mississippi public schools.
Minority enrollment is 90% of the student body (majority Black), which is more than the Mississippi public school average of 57% (majority Black).
